             Soiled 
            (1925) United States of America 
            B&W : Seven reels / 6800 feet 
            Directed by Fred Windemere 
            Cast: Kenneth Harlan [Jimmie York], Vivian Martin [Mary Brown], Mildred Harris [Pet Darling], Johnny Walker (Johnnie Walker) [Wilbur Brown], Mary Alden [Mrs. Brown], Robert Cain [John Duane], Wyndham Standing [James P. Munson], Maude George [Bess Duane], Alec B. Francis [Rollo Tetheridge], John T. Mack 
            Phil Goldstone Productions production; distributed on State Rights basis by Truart Film Corporation. / Scenario by J.F. Natteford, from the short story “Debt of Dishonor” by Jack Boyle. Cinematography by Bert Baldridge. Additional cinematography by Edgar Lyons. / No copyright registration. Released [?] 1 November 1924 or 8 March 1925? / Standard 35mm spherical 1.33:1 format. 
            Drama. 
            Survival status: The film is presumed lost. 
            Current rights holder: Public domain [USA]. 
            Listing updated: 4 December 2023. 
            References: FilmYearBook-1926 p. 55 : Website-AFI; Website-ASFFDb.
